Shot on 8mm film in 1971, this vintage home movie captures a tranquil ranch landscape in California. Lush green trees and cacti sway gently in the wind against a backdrop of rugged mountains. A dark statue stands prominently in the foreground, adding an artistic element to the natural setting. The footage features natural film grain and subtle color shifts typical of Super 8 home movies, evoking a nostalgic, mid-century American atmosphere. The camera pans slowly across the scene, revealing a rustic building nestled among the foliage.
